Beautiful wedding in Karlstejn castle

A beautiful castle wedding is one of the brightest and most memorable events in life. I’ve luckily captured the best moments of one. Meet this passionate couple- Raisa and Iva and their marvelous wedding in Czech Republic.

Wedding in Prague

The couple chose Karlstejn castle as a place for the wedding ceremony. There is no better place for it. Majestic fortress overlooks River Berionka and inspires to join in marriage in one of the oldest places of Czech Republic.This photo session against towers impresses deeply.
